body{

	margin:0;

	background-color:#8e8a7f;

	font-family: Verdana, Arial, Helvetica, sans-serif;

	font-size:11px;

	color:#FFFFFF;

}

a{color:#FFFFFF;}

p{margin:10px 0;}

img{border:0;}

#page_con {

	margin:0 auto;

	width: 776px;

}

#header_con {

	background-image: url(/img/header_bg.jpg);

	padding: 0 16px;

}

#header_left {

	float: left;

	width: 543px;

	padding: 0 10px;

}

#logo {

	height: 40px;

	padding: 26px 0 0 10px;

	margin:0 -10px 10px -10px;

	background-image: url(/img/logo_bg.jpg);

	font-size:14px;

	letter-spacing:4px;

}

#header_right {

	float: left;

	width: 160px;

	background: url(/img/header_right.jpg) no-repeat;

	padding: 70px 0 0 20px;

}

#content_top {

	background: url(/img/content_top.jpg) no-repeat;

	height:134px;

}

#top_nav {

	height: 25px;

	text-align:center;

	padding:20px 0 0 0;

}

#top_nav a{

	text-decoration:none;

	padding: 0 8px;

	font-size:12px;

	letter-spacing:1px;

}

#releases{

	color:#38330d;

	text-align:left;

	padding:10px 0 0 110px;

}

#content_con {background: url(/img/content_bg.jpg);}

#content {

	background: url(/img/footer.jpg) no-repeat left bottom;

	padding:10px 30px 30px 30px;

}

#content_left {

	background: url(/img/content_sp.jpg) no-repeat right bottom;

	float: left;

	width: 404px;

	height: auto;

}

#news a{color:#38330d; font-weight:bold}

#newstitle{

	background: url(/img/news.gif) no-repeat;

	height: 38px;

	display:block;

	width:140px;

	margin-bottom:5px;

}

#content_right {

	background: url(/img/content_right.jpg) no-repeat right bottom;

	float: left;

	width: 297px;

	padding:0 0 0 15px;

	height:505px;

}

#listentosamples{

	background: url(/img/listentosamples.gif) no-repeat;

	height: 14px;

}

.tdwhite{

	color:#ffffff;

	background-color:#6a685d;

	text-align:center;

}

.tdwhite a{

	text-decoration:none;

	padding:0 5px;

}

.tddarkgreen{

	color:#38330d;

	background-color:#8e8a80;

}

#footer {

	line-height: 20px;

	text-align:center;

	padding-bottom:10px;

}

#footer a{

	text-decoration:none;

	padding:0 5px;

}

.clear{clear:both;}

.darkgreen{color:#38330d}

.floatleft{float:left;}

.bold{font-weight:bold}

.title{font-size:20px;font-weight:bold}

